Reports indicate that the singer tied the knot with a young Muslim businessman in a low-key function held under tight security.
Songstress Lydia Jazmine is reported to have secretly got married in a private Nikkah ceremony.

Jazmine, whose real name is Lydia Nabawanuka, embraced Islam and adopted the name “Yazmin” ahead of the ceremony according to reports that circulated Monday morning.

Several outlets and media personalities alleged that the singer tied the knot with a young Muslim businessman in a low-key function held under tight security.

“In other news Singer Lydia Jazmines Board of Directors (Friends) are hinting to us that she did a Nika… mbu she’s now officially taken. Congra congra,” reported Douglas Lwanga

Another social media post shared by entertainment commentator Wayne Frank Ntambi claimed the singer had converted to Islam ahead of the ceremony.

Secrecy around the ceremony

According to online reports, the alleged ceremony was attended by only close family members and a few trusted friends.

Jazmine had not publicly confirmed or denied the reports by Sunday afternoon.

The singer also did not post any official photos or statements relating to the alleged marriage ceremony on her verified social media pages.
